Interior designers offer 5 win-win color combinations and countless ideas for decorating your home and festive table for the New Year.
If you want your interior to become truly elegant on holidays, add at least a little gold to it.
It is known that a large amount of gold is present in the interiors of the Baroque, Empire and Art Deco. This is all true. But gold accessories, details, ornaments feel great in a modern setting. And gilded dishes of laconic forms will be a wonderful decoration for any table. You can choose any color as a background, but the combination of gold and white looks especially solemn. It is known that the red color is very active, which means that in large quantities it can quickly tire not only the hosts, but also the guests. Therefore, the designer uses it carefully. One wall is painted in red, plus it is present in the form of accessories: decorative pillows, tablecloths, Christmas tree decorations. The main load is assigned to the white color. And yet a painting in red and white would leave a feeling of incompleteness, if not for one more color, no less traditional for the New Year’s holiday – green. Holly and mint sprigs pleasantly enliven the table setting, and spruce branches serve as an elegant addition to the table setting.
With such a contrasting combination of colors chosen for decorating the living room, it is better not to complicate the serving. White ceramic or porcelain plates, transparent glasses are a simple, but most suitable solution.

The optimal coloristic solution for a holiday with the family will be a combination of white and red. These colors are traditional for Catholic Christmas. In addition, white and red go well with yellow, which is painted on the walls of the dining room.
If we talk about table setting, the designer suggests opting for transparent glass and white ceramics. Glasses for wine and champagne are required, as well as several plates of different diameters, for example, for appetizers, main course and dessert. The design elements can be candlesticks, napkins with a New Year’s pattern and … various Christmas tree decorations.
To many, such a coloristic decision will probably seem too bold. However, black color, namely, it sets the tone in this living-dining room, has long become a full-fledged element of the palette of Christmas tree decorations and other attributes of the New Year’s holiday. In addition, white is usually offered as a companion to him, and with such a tandem, you see, there is little that compares to the solemnity and theatricality of the created effect. However, if you decide to use black and white, you should not be too zealous with the use of dark paint. Even if there is no problem with natural light indoors. See how our designer carefully introduces it into the interior. Only the walls in the rooms are black, plus a very small amount of decor items.
This living-dining room has acquired warmth and coziness due to the furnishings chosen by the designer. All of them are made of light natural wood. And it is also used as a floor covering.
